About

Laura Ermert is a scholar working on Geophysics, Artificial Intelligence and Civil and Structural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Laura Ermert has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 411 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Geophysics, 11 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 1 paper in Civil and Structural Engineering. Recurrent topics in Laura Ermert's work include Seismic Waves and Analysis (18 papers), Seismic Imaging and Inversion Techniques (13 papers) and Seismology and Earthquake Studies (11 papers). Laura Ermert is often cited by papers focused on Seismic Waves and Analysis (18 papers), Seismic Imaging and Inversion Techniques (13 papers) and Seismology and Earthquake Studies (11 papers). Laura Ermert coll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, United States and France. Laura Ermert's co-authors include Andreas Fichtner, Christian Boehm, Antonio Villaseñor, Laurent Stehly, Lion Krischer, Michael Afanasiev, Donat Fäh, Valerio Poggi, Jan Burjánek and Daniel Bowden and has published in prestigious journals such as Geophysics, Geophysical Journal International and Journal of Geophysical Research Solid Earth.
